Is Ashtabula, OH a Good Place to Live?
Ashtabula receives an overall livability grade of C (48/100), suggesting room for improvement compared to other areas in Ohio. Safety scores C+ (51/100). Affordability scores C (48/100) with a median household income of $47,370 and median home values around $113,400.
About 15.2%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the unemployment rate is 10.8%. 65% of housing is owner-occupied. The median age is 43.
